Understanding Payday Loans in Rockville, Rhode Island
Payday loans are legal in Rhode Island. Residents of Rockville can access payday loans to meet their immediate financial needs. Payday loans, also known as cash advances, are short-term loans that have high interest and fees. These loans provide quick access to cash but may trap borrowers in a cycle of debt. How Do Payday Loans Work?
Payday loans are typically small loans that are due by the borrower’s next payday. The lender may require the borrower to write a postdated check for the loan amount plus fees or may require access to the borrower’s bank account to withdraw the funds on the due date. In Rockville, Rhode Island, payday loan amounts cannot exceed $500, and the loan term cannot be less than 13 days or more than 31 days.
- Interest Rates and Fees: Payday loans have high interest rates and fees. In Rhode Island, payday lenders can charge up to 260% APR on a 14-day loan. Lenders can also charge a 10% transaction fee on the loan amount, up to a maximum of $30. For example, if you borrow $100 for 14 days, the lender can charge up to $24 in interest and $10 as a transaction fee, bringing the total cost of the loan to $134.
- Rollovers and Renewals: Rhode Island law does not allow rollovers or renewals of payday loans. Borrowers must pay off the loan in full and wait at least one day before taking out another loan from the same lender.
- Repayment: If you cannot repay the loan on the due date, the lender may charge a non-sufficient funds (NSF) fee and you may incur additional interest and fees. The lender may also file a civil lawsuit against you to collect the loan amount.
Requirements for Payday Loans in Rockville, Rhode Island
To apply for a payday loan in Rockville, Rhode Island, you must meet the following requirements.
- Age and Residency: You must be 18 years or older and a permanent resident or citizen of the United States.
- Income and Employment: You must have a steady source of income and employment. The lender may require proof of income, such as a pay stub.
- Bank Account: You must have an active bank account in your name.
- Identification: You must provide a valid government-issued photo ID, such as a driver’s license or passport.
